Bloomin' Brands (NASDAQ:BLMN - Get Free Report) updated its FY 2026 earnings guidance on Wednesday. The company provided EPS guidance of 0.750-0.900 for the period, compared to the consensus EPS estimate of 0.830. The company issued revenue guidance of -. Bloomin' Brands also updated its Q2 2026 guidance to 0.270-0.320 EPS.

Bloomin' Brands Stock Performance

Shares of Bloomin' Brands stock opened at $5.76 on Wednesday. The firm has a fifty day moving average of $5.95 and a two-hundred day moving average of $6.54. The stock has a market capitalization of $490.92 million, a price-to-earnings ratio of 57.61, a PEG ratio of 4.76 and a beta of 1.10. Bloomin' Brands has a 52 week low of $5.19 and a 52 week high of $10.70.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 2.34, a quick ratio of 0.24 and a current ratio of 0.31.

Bloomin' Brands (NASDAQ:BLMN - Get Free Report) last issued its earnings results on Wednesday, May 6th. The restaurant operator reported $0.67 EPS for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$0.57 by $0.10. The company had revenue of $1.06 billion during the quarter, compared to analysts' expectations of $1.04 billion. Bloomin' Brands had a net margin of 0.21% and a return on equity of 26.26%. Bloomin' Brands has set its FY 2026 guidance at 0.750-0.900 EPS and its Q2 2026 guidance at 0.270-0.320 EPS. As a group, equities research analysts predict that Bloomin' Brands will post 0.82 EPS for the current year.

Wall Street Analyst Weigh In

Several analysts have commented on BLMN shares. Citigroup upped their target price on shares of Bloomin' Brands from $6.75 to $7.00 and gave the company a "neutral" rating in a research report on Thursday, February 26th. Weiss Ratings reiterated a "sell (d)" rating on shares of Bloomin' Brands in a research report on Friday, March 27th. Finally, JPMorgan Chase & Co. lowered shares of Bloomin' Brands from a "neutral" rating to an "underweight" rating and set a $6.00 price target for the company. in a report on Friday, April 24th. Six research analysts have rated the stock with a Hold rating and two have assigned a Sell rating to the stock. According to MarketBeat, the company presently has a consensus rating of "Reduce" and an average target price of $7.86.

Insider Activity

In other news, Director Rohit Lal purchased 10,000 shares of the firm's stock in a transaction dated Wednesday, March 11th. The stock was bought at an average price of $5.69 per share, with a total value of $56,900.00. Following the acquisition, the director directly owned 30,156 shares of the company's stock, valued at approximately $171,587.64. This represents a 49.61% increase in their ownership of the stock. The transaction was disclosed in a document filed with the SEC, which is available at this hyperlink. 1.18% of the stock is owned by company insiders.

Bloomin' Brands Company Profile

(Get Free Report)

Bloomin' Brands, Inc engages in the ownership, operation and franchising of casual dining restaurants worldwide. The company's portfolio includes five full-service restaurant chains: Outback Steakhouse, known for its Australian-inspired steakhouse concept; Carrabba's Italian Grill, offering Italian-American cuisine; Bonefish Grill, specializing in handcrafted seafood dishes; Fleming's Prime Steakhouse & Wine Bar, focusing on premium steak and wine experiences; and Aussie Grill by Outback, featuring a streamlined menu of signature items.
